
Clarification of structural characterization and hydrogen storage mechanism in nano-composite materials including light elements and nanostructured carbon prepared by a mechanical ballmilling method. Practical studies of the nano-composite materials and the nanostructured carbon for application to hydrogen and electric energy storages.

Experimental study of fundamental material properties and reactivity for light elements based materials. Main subjects are research and development of hydrogen production, hydrogen storage, and material conversion. Functional materials are newly created through research on material properties and reaction mechanism by original sample synthesis methods and various analyses from wide points of view.
